嵌入式linux查看内核版本
时间: 2024-07-04 21:00:47 浏览: 184
在嵌入式Linux系统中,查看内核版本通常可以通过命令行来操作,以下是几种常见的方法:
1. 使用`uname -r
3.18.0-rc1-omap4-g6c147a4
```
2. 在终端输入`cat /proc/version`:这个命令会显示内核的主要版本、子版本和补丁级别等信息。
3. 登录到shell后,打开`/etc/os-release`文件(如果存在),该文件通常包含内核版本信息,例如:
```
PRETTY_NAME="Linux <kernel-version> on <platform>"
```
4. 如果你使用的是 BusyBox 环境,可以尝试运行`busybox --version`,它可能包含了内核信息。
相关问题:
1. 在嵌入式Linux中,如何通过命令查看内核的修订版?
2. `uname -a`命令除了内核版本,还显示哪些系统信息?
3. `/etc/os-release`文件的内容一般包含哪些关于操作系统的信息?
相关问题
嵌入式Linux的内核的阐述
嵌入式Linux的内核是一种经过裁剪和优化的Linux内核,它通常被用于嵌入式设备中,如智能手机、智能家居设备等。这种内核尽可能地减小了系统资源的占用,并提供了必要的硬件驱动程序支持,以保证设备的正常工作。同时,嵌入式Linux的内核也具备一定的灵活性,可以针对具体的应用场景进行个性化的配置和优化。
嵌入式Linux关闭内核打印信息
在嵌入式 Linux 中,可以通过修改内核配置来关闭内核打印信息。
如果使用的是 Buildroot 等工具构建 rootfs 和内核,可以在构建时选择配置 `BR2_ENABLE_DEBUG` 和 `BR2_ENABLE_DEBUG_LL` 选项来开启或关闭内核打印信息。
如果是手动编译内核,则可以在 `.config` 文件中配置以下选项:
```
CONFIG_PRINTK=n
```
其中,`CONFIG_PRINTK` 选项为打印信息总开关,将其值改为 `n` 即可关闭内核打印信息。
修改完成后,重新编译内核即可生效。
阅读全文